Systems have already been proposed in which the rear environment of a motor vehicle can be detected by means of a camera. The environmental image generated in this way may be displayed on a display means, e.g. As a monitor or a display, are displayed. In certain driving situations, eg. B. when reversing or when parking or parking, the driver can monitor in this way certain non-visible areas of the environment, whereby the risk of collisions or accidents is reduced.

As a result, a subsequent road user an image of the area in front of the motor vehicle is displayed, which is hidden by the motor vehicle. In this way, a subsequent road user can recognize a potentially dangerous situation earlier, eg. B. a braking vehicle that is in front of the with the. Camera equipped vehicle or one of "yellow" to "red" switching traffic light, whereby braking maneuvers of the preceding vehicles are triggered. The display means arranged at the rear of the motor vehicle can preferably be provided in addition to a display means in the cockpit of the motor vehicle, on which certain information is made available to the driver. It is also not necessary for the same information to be displayed on the inner display means arranged in the cockpit and the outer display means arranged on the rear of the motor vehicle. Instead, it is possible to display on the external display means z. B. only such information is displayed, which are relevant to the safety of subsequent road users.

The provision of a camera at these points is already known in principle, so that a camera provided for another information or security system can also be used for the present invention. Accordingly, the need for additional hardware required to implement the invention is reduced. It can also be provided that the motor vehicle according to the invention comprises a plurality of cameras, each of which generates an environmental image, wherein one of the environmental images or an image composed of a plurality of environmental images can be displayed on the display means. It is possible to generate a composite image from a plurality of individual images in order to be able to image a larger angular range of the surroundings on the display means. For example, a composite image could be generated that also detects lane edges and intersections. Preferably, such an image may extend over an angular range of 90 ° -180 °.

Such a sensor can detect the environment behind the motor vehicle and preferably be designed as a tail radar or as a rear camera. Accordingly, the displayed image z. B. are shown enlarged, if the distance between the vehicle according to the invention and the subsequent vehicle is large. Conversely, the displayed image can be displayed in a reduced size. when the distance is small. Preferably, the detected distance is adjusted by a vehicle-specific correction value of the following vehicle, which contains information about the distance between the position of the driver and the front end of the following vehicle. This provides the traffic behind a more realistic representation of the traffic situation.

The representation of a sequence of individual images or a film enables tracking of the traffic situation in front of the vehicle ahead in real time. Accordingly, a motor vehicle equipped with the camera of the following drivers can detect dangerous situations earlier or situations requiring action, such as the lighting of brake lights, a traffic light turning red or other road users such as pedestrians or vehicles in dangerous situations Area are located. Since driving in particular in city traffic often with a small distance behind each other, can be responded in good time by the early detection of a dangerous situation based on the displayed on the display means environment image, whereby an accident can be avoided.

The monitor is comparatively large, so that the relevant traffic can already be detected by a subsequent driver from a distance. Alternatively, it can also be provided that the display means is designed as a foil display. Film displays have the advantage that they are comparatively thin, so that they can be relatively easily integrated into the rear of a motor vehicle. Such a film display can be partially or completely translucent, accordingly, a translucent film display can also be mounted in front of a rear window.
